Christmas Math Order of Slides Slide 1------ Christmas Math, Name, grade, date, year Slide 2------explanation of task, how much you thought you could spend on each person. Slide 3------Gift List, budget, and how much to spend on each person. Slide 4------ Person 1 (gift pic snip, cost) Slide 5------ Person 2 (gift pic snip, cost) Slide 6------Person 3 (gift pic snip, cost) Slide 7------ Person 4 (gift pic snip, cost) Slide 8------ Person 5 (gift pic snip, cost) Slide 9------ Person 6(gift pic snip, cost) Slide 10---- Person 7 (gift pic snip, cost) and so on (as above) until you finish with gift list. Slide 11-----table with name, gift, cost. At this point find 10%tax and 5%shipping. Add cost , tax, and shipping for grand total. Slide 12----Import Excel Pie Graph to slide Slide 13---- What I liked about the project Slide 14---- What I learned
